Its basic and standard plan prices will go up by £1 a month, to £6.99 and £10.99 respectively.

Customers will be charged an extra £2 for the premium package, which will now cost £15.99.

The price increase will be brought in immediately for new customers.

Existing members will be told about the changes at least 30 days before they are charged.

The price change also impacts Ireland, where prices will be increased by €1 and €2 in sync with the UK.



Netflix said the increase will allow it to "continue investing in best in class UK productions" and "offer a wide variety of curated quality shows and films" to customers.

A Netflix spokesperson said: "We have always been focused on providing our members both quality and clear value for their membership.

"Our updated prices reflect the investment we have made in our service and catalogue, and will allow us to continue making the series, documentaries and films our members love as well as investing in talent and the creative industry.

"We offer a range of plans so members can choose a price that works best for them."
